Sempermed® Syntegra UV – award-winning surgical glove
A further highlight at the Sempermed trade fair stand is the patented Sempermed® Syntegra UV. This product innovation enabled Sempermed to become the world’s first producer to offer a surgical glove from the natural latex-related material polyisoprene, which is interlinked by ultraviolet light instead of allergenic accelerator chemicals. At the same time, it also offers the wearing comfort of a latex glove. In this way Sempermed® Syntegra UV fulfils the special needs of users who suffer from a type-I allergy (latex incompatibility) which can be triggered by accelerators in production processes (type-IV allergy). The glove has the feel of natural latex with respect to its sense of touch and snugness. “The skin-friendly glove Sempermed® Syntegra UV is highly recommended for sensitive areas such as emergency surgery and paediatrics. About Semperit
The publicly listed company Semperit AG Holding is an internationally-oriented group that develops, produces, and sells in more than 100 countries highly specialised rubber and plastic products for the medical and industrial sectors: examination and surgical gloves, hydraulic and industrial hoses, conveyor belts, escalator handrails, construction profiles, cable car rings, and products for railway superstructures. The headquarters of this longstanding Austrian company, which was founded in 1824, are located in Vienna, and the global R & D centre is in Wimpassing, Lower Austria. The Semperit Group employs about 11,200 people worldwide, including more than 7,000 in Asia and more than 700 in Austria (Vienna and production site in Wimpassing, Lower Austria). The Group has 22 manufacturing facilities worldwide and numerous sales offices in Europe, Asia, and America. In 2013 the group generated sales of EUR 906 million and an EBITDA of EUR 133 million.
